用分层法合成了两个配合物[Ag2(L)2](CF3COO)2(1)和[Ag2(L)2](CF3SO3)2(2)[L=2-甲基-4,6-二(3-吡啶基)嘧啶],并用元素分析、红外光谱、X-射线单晶衍射等手段对其进行了表征。晶体结构分析结果表明:具有双核大环结构的配合物1和2由Ag(Ⅰ)…Ag(Ⅰ)相互作用连接形成一维链状结构,并进一步通过π-π相互作用形成二维层状结构。研究了配合物2的荧光性质。
Two complexes [Ag2 (L) 2] (CF3COO) 2 (1) and [Ag2 (L) 2] (CF3SO3) 2 (2) [L = 2-methyl-4,6 - bis (3-pyridyl) pyrimidine] was synthesized and characterized by elemental analysis, IR and X-ray single crystal diffraction. The results of crystal structure analysis show that complexes 1 and 2 with double nuclei macrocyclic structure are connected by Ag (Ⅰ) ... Ag (Ⅰ) to form a one-dimensional chain structure and form a two-dimensional layered structure through π-π interaction structure. The fluorescence properties of complex 2 were studied.
